MAPON efg result of 54Mn in cubic cobalt

Full text: The high resolution spectroscopy, Modulated Adiabatic Passage on Oriented Nuclei (MAPON), provides precise quantifiable mode values for the very small electric field gradient (efg) present at substitutional 3d impurities in crystallographic cubic ferromagnets, Fe, Ni and fcc Co. In conjunction with the much older technique of Adiabatic Fast Passage NMR on oriented nuclei, signs of the efg may be readily determined, leading to increasingly well-defined efg systematics as nuclear quadrupole moments improve in reliability in both sign and magnitude through calculation and experiment. For 3d impurities the efg mode values are, in general, an order of magnitude smaller than those found for 5d impurities in like hosts but are, nevertheless, over an order of magnitude larger than that assigned to distant point defects in undeformed non-magnetic cubic hosts. It has been argued previously that for the 3d probe the dominant mechanism for the efg is distinct from those of the other two categories, being probe intrinsic for a given host, but strongly host dependent for a given probe. In particular, and in contrast to 5d impurities such as Ir, there are efg sign changes depending on whether the ferromagnetic host is either bcc or fcc. From the systematics in hand, it was apparent that Mn in fcc Co should be the same sign efg as Mn in fcc Ni and much the same magnitude. In this paper we present a new MAPON result for the 54Mn (I = 3+, t1/2 = 312 d) probe in polycrystalline, predominantly fcc, cobalt foils which is entirely consistent in sign and magnitude with this empirical prediction. We obtain, using Q= +0.33(3) b, an efg for MnCo (fcc) of Vzz = +1.25(17) x1019Vm-2
